Hi,
If ALL the led's are flashing then the main power board needs replacing, however, if just some of the led's are flashing then its gone into error, the lights flashing give a code, more info needed like model number? and which lights flashing.
As i said, if its ALL the lighst then new power module needed.

Hi i have aburning smell coming from the machine
Be sure the lint filter is clean, and the temp sensor blown clean. Sometimes when cleaning the lint filter the some small amount of lint drops by the filter or screen and land on a hot spot. Lint can catch fire so clean with a air hose or vacuum cleaner - Good luck and be safe

How to attache drive belt to drive drum
Remove rear cover of washer, and top cover also, tilt washer towards you, get someone to hold washer steady, fit belt round motor pulley,and slowly feed belt round drum pulley, watch your fingers, keep feeding belt round oulley, turning drum at same time, it will be tight, but persist, and belt will go on.

I need to remove the bearings from the drum of my
Its not impossible but a real battle without the correct tools. If at the back of your washer, you have the main arm assembly, then firstly remove the belt and then the pulley.Undo the nuts holding the assembly and in short, pull that assembly off by pulling it towards yourself. Once off, you will see the bearings and seal that need to be replaced. Once done, reassemble carefully and god luck.
